Description

Assignment Description
The Sr. Payroll Coordinator is responsible for providing cross-functional support to the HR team and for the day-to-day administration and processing of Company payroll using ADP Workforce Now. Maintains strict confidentiality and assists employees with payroll and administrative HR matters.

QUALIFICATIONS REQUIRED

  • Must have pervious experience specifically in payroll and/or payroll processing, preferably utilizing ADP Workforce Now
  • Detail oriented with sound knowledge of payroll administration, including state and federal regulations including tax withholdings
  • Strong experience operating in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, PowerPoint, Word and Outlook).
  • Strong understanding of payroll and tax withholding compliance obligations.
  • Strong organizational skills and the ability to work under pressure and meet deadlines.
  • Capable of working independently as well as within a team.
  • Excellent communication and customer service skills.
  • Possess strong ethical standards regarding the handling of confidential information
  • Capable of effective planning and priority setting.
  • Strong analytical skills and a thorough knowledge payroll processing.
  • Proficient reading, writing, grammar and mathematics skills.
  • Computer proficiency and technical aptitude with the ability to utilize ADP, WFN, M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, and internal databases.
  • Intermediate Excel Skills, and Intermediate/Advanced Word, PowerPoint.
Responsibilities
  • Prepare employee paychecks and direct deposit remittances, maintaining payroll related information in an accurate and in compliance with state and federal laws
  • Ensure accurate processing of all mandatory and voluntary deductions as well as garnishments, liens, direct deposit requests, deductions, etc.
  • Assist employees with Time & Attendance issues in WFS.
  • Serve as primary contract regarding payroll processing issues; research and resolve payroll related questions from employees and managers.
  • Investigate discrepancies and provide information in non-routing situations.
  • Maintain and update employee data and records in HRIS systems and employee personnel files in Content Server.
  • Deliver employee payroll checks and reports.
  • Stay abreast of legislative changes to comply with all federal, local, and state regulations that impact payroll.
  • Maintains current knowledge of applicable state and federal wage and hour laws.
  • Facilitate employee understanding of payroll practices and procedures.
  • Processes, maintains, and communicates taxable fringe benefits on a monthly, quarterly, and annual basis for exempt and assigned vehicles, education, housing, fitness memberships, and other benefits as applicable.
  • Participates in quarterly expenditure and fringe benefit monitoring meeting
  • Maintains departmental company credit cards and expense reporting.
  • Assists with employee leave management administration as it pertains to payroll.
